    Comments Thread For: Coach Cunningham Believes Stakes Are High For Tszyu and Thurman

    Kevin Cunningham believes that both Keith Thurman and Tim Tszyu's legacies could be impacted by their upcoming fight. Thurman and Tszyu face each other on March 30 at the T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as, Nevada on Amazon Prime pay-per-view.
